Isabelle's Ghost Bat vs Rainbow Bluet
Diclidurus isabella compared with Enallagma antennatum
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Isabelle's Ghost Bat | Rainbow Bluet |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Chiroptera (Bats) | Odonata (Odonata) |
| Family | Emballonuridae | Coenagrionidae |
| Genus | Diclidurus | Enallagma |
| Species | Diclidurus isabella | Enallagma antennatum |
Evolutionary Relationship
Isabelle's Ghost Bat and Rainbow Bluet share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
